No. 48: Lover in the Rough

Lover in the Rough by Elizabeth Lowell

I grabbed a book at random off the shelf and this is what I got. It was not a good pick. Not only do I HATE the title, this book featured an excess of all the things I dislike about Elizabeth Lowell (terrible dialogue and descriptions), and none of the stuff I liked. The plot was lame, no mystery or excitement. The only conflict was based on a stupid misunderstanding that would have never happened if the characters in the book acted like real people. So irritating! One of those where if one person had told the other person something at the beginning, the whole conflict would have been avoided. But they didn't tell, so when the other person finds out the "secret" they get mad and confused and they think that everything they ever thought/felt was a lie. But really it is just a stupid misunderstanding. I don't think words can express how irritating that type of plot is to me!
